首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

bpf_get_current_pid_tgid()在Linux04.04.15中的bpf程序的socket_filter类型中返回'not found‘错误

bpf_get_current_pid_tgid()函数是一种用于在Linux内核中编写BPF(Berkeley Packet Filter)程序的函数。它的作用是获取当前进程的PID和TGID(Thread Group ID),并将其作为返回值。然而,在Linux 4.4.15内核版本的bpf程序的socket_filter类型中,当调用bpf_get_current_pid_tgid()函数时,可能会返回"not found"错误。

BPF是一种在内核中执行高性能数据包过滤和操作的虚拟机。它允许用户编写安全、高效的网络应用程序和过滤逻辑。socket_filter类型的BPF程序是一种特殊的BPF程序,可以用于过滤和操作套接字层级的网络数据包。通过在套接字层级上执行过滤,可以提高网络应用程序的性能和安全性。

然而,在Linux 4.4.15内核版本中,当在socket_filter类型的BPF程序中调用bpf_get_current_pid_tgid()函数时,可能会遇到'not found'错误。这可能是由于内核版本的限制或错误导致的。为了解决这个问题,可以尝试升级内核到更高的版本,或者查看内核文档、社区论坛等资源,以获取更多关于该错误的解决方案。

在腾讯云的产品生态系统中,我无法直接给出特定的产品推荐或链接地址,但腾讯云提供了丰富的云计算相关产品和服务,包括云服务器、容器服务、CDN加速、云数据库等,可以满足各种应用场景的需求。您可以访问腾讯云官方网站或联系腾讯云的客服团队,获取更多关于适用于您具体需求的产品和解决方案的信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

6分9秒

054.go创建error的四种方式

1分51秒

Ranorex Studio简介

10分30秒

053.go的error入门

7分13秒

049.go接口的nil判断

2分25秒

090.sync.Map的Swap方法

36秒

PS使用教程:如何在Mac版Photoshop中画出对称的图案?

16分8秒

Tspider分库分表的部署 - MySQL

22秒

PS使用教程:如何在Mac版Photoshop中新建A4纸?

3分54秒

PS使用教程:如何在Mac版Photoshop中制作烟花效果?

领券